Peak Gymnastics Academy offers a robust and diverse portfolio of programs, catering to a wide spectrum of athletic interests and ages, confirming its status as a premier sports complex in the North Carolina region:
- Preschool Classes: Specialized sessions designed for the youngest athletes (often ages 3-4), focusing on fundamental movement, coordination, and the very basics of gymnastics in a fun, structured environment.
- Youth Classes / Recreational Program: Beginner’s Classes, Intermediate, and Advanced Classes (Rec 1, Rec 2, Rec 3) for girls and boys, providing a developmental path through fundamental gymnastics skills.
- Tumbling and All-Star Cheerleading Program: Dedicated classes for tumbling skills, as well as the full competitive commitment of the Carolina Thunder All-Star Cheerleading team.
- Competitive Gymnastics: Advanced training and Competition Training for the Women's Artistic Team, including Compulsory and Optional levels, competing in USAG-sanctioned events.
- Private Lessons: One-on-one coaching for gymnasts and cheerleaders seeking highly focused instruction on specific skills, technique refinement, or event preparation.
- Camps / Summer Camp: Fun, fitness-based experiences that combine gymnastics fundamentals with typical camp activities, often following a weekly theme (a feature praised by customers who "LOVED" their camp experience).
- Group Class: Standard weekly sessions for recreational development in gymnastics and tumbling.
- Gymnastics Events & Obstacle Courses: Offering a variety of activities to engage participants, including specialized obstacle courses for fun and functional strength building.
- Trial Class: An opportunity for prospective members to experience a class firsthand before committing to a full program.
- Open Gym: Scheduled times for members and non-members to practice skills, explore the equipment, and enjoy unstructured time in a supervised environment.
- Private Party: The facility is available for hosting special events, such as hassle-free birthday parties for children.

★ 5★ 4★ 3★ 2★ 1I don’t recommend the recreational classes here. They only care about the cheer team here. There always a lot going on and it’s hard for the new kids to find their classes. The coaches don’t come out to get the kids. I mentioned this and was told they only come out for the little kids the older kids know where to go. My daughter is 9 not sure how she is expected to know which is her coach in a group of unknown adults that none asked her where she need to go. She said she was overwhelmed and didn’t want to go up and randomly ask someone. The lady at the front said she would help but she after she finished signing someone up, just seems unorganized. If your looking for a tumble class there are definitely better ran places then this one, overall just messy and unorganized.

January 26 · Mimi22I am the luckiest mom in the world. From the moment my daughter and I stepped foot in the doors of Peak Gymnastics Academy, we knew this was home. I knew my daughter wasn't just a number or a means to make more money. In fact, though we came from a team prior to moving here, the coaches at PGA placed my daughter in recreational to develop some of her deficits first before putting her on a team. We've been with PGA now for 7 years. This is home for us. The care and consideration that comes from the top down in this organization is exactly what I would want for any gymnast and mom (or dad). My daughter is loved here and truly HATES when she's not in the gym. Did I already say that this is home for us. I could go on about how knowledgeable the staff is about necessary skulls and PT for specific injuries but those are things you would expect from a gym. What makes PEAK special is the HEART of its owner, Angie, and her staff. It makes me sad to see my daughter's career coming to an end because that means we have to say good bye soon but I know for sure that we will always have a home here!
